The ignition lock is a crucial element of modern vehicles, designed to prevent unauthorized access and theft. However, there are many synonyms for this term, including key lock, starter switch, engine start button, ignition switch, and start-lock mechanism. Each of these terms refers to a particular aspect of the ignition lock, such as the physical lock that prevents the key from being turned, the electrical switch that activates the engine, or the button that triggers the start sequence. Regardless of the terminology used, the ignition lock plays a critical role in ensuring the safety and security of the vehicle and its passengers.
